NASCAR official details the no-caution call for Cody Ware's late crash at The Glen
Managing director Brad Moran cites debris protocols and vehicle mobility as key factors in race control’s call

NASCAR’s managing director for the Cup Series, Brad Moran, has clarified the race control decision not to issue a caution flag following Cody Ware’s late-race crash at Watkins Glen International. The incident, which occurred late in the event at The Glen, saw Ware’s No. 51 Rick Ware Racing car sustain significant damage to the Turn 7 railing. Despite the severity of the impact, the vehicle remained under power, allowing Ware to drive to pit road before retiring the car.

Moran explained that race control did not deploy a yellow flag because the car cleared the incident scene without shedding debris. “We weren’t going to throw it at that point unless debris came off the car,” Moran stated during his weekly appearance on SiriusXM NASCAR Radio. He noted that while corner workers in Turns 1, the esses, the bus stop, and Turn 6 were on official radios, track workers operated on a separate frequency. A local ‘blue’ flag was in effect during the incident, and Ware drove away from the scene within seconds of the collision.

The decision has drawn scrutiny following the race, as television coverage by FOX did not show replays of the crash during the broadcast. Post-race in-car footage revealed the proximity Ware came to careening off the railing and back into oncoming traffic. The lack of immediate visual confirmation on television led to discussion among commentators and fans regarding whether the incident warranted a safety pause.

Addressing the communication protocols, Moran detailed the layered radio systems in place at the track. He confirmed that the corner workers were equipped with official radios, while local track personnel utilised a different frequency. The tower operator, who was also part of the official track staff, coordinated these efforts. The absence of immediate debris and the car’s continued mobility were the primary determinants in the race control tower’s decision-making process.

NASCAR is currently exploring technological solutions to enhance incident detection in future events. Moran indicated that the series is working with its safety team to utilise the new Engine Control Unit (ECU), which is being introduced for the first time this weekend. The organisation is evaluating the integration of the iDash incident recording system to automatically signal hard impacts to race control.

However, the timeline for these improvements remains undefined. Moran acknowledged that the new ECU has not yet been used in a race, meaning the solution is still under development. The safety team is assessing how to leverage the new hardware to provide the tower with more immediate data on the significance of collisions, potentially preventing similar debates over caution flags in the future.

“We never stop working on safety,” Moran said. “When we get an incident like this, we go back and take and look and see what can change or what can be done differently.” The series continues to review its protocols following incidents to determine if operational changes can be implemented to improve driver safety and race management.
